    The Jieli BR21 (also associated with Zhuhai Jieli Technology) is primarily a Bluetooth audio receiver and controller often found in USB dongles, car adapters, and Bluetooth mixers. It is frequently identified by the hardware ID VID: e5b7, PID: 0811. Driver Summary

    Operating System Compatibility: The device typically uses standard USB Audio Class and HID drivers built into Windows 10/11 and Linux (kernel 5.x+), meaning no third-party "full" driver installation is usually required.

    Device Identification: In many cases, Windows will list it as a "JieLi BR21 Stereo" or simply a "USB Composite Device".

    Update Tools: For firmware-level modifications, Jieli provides the JL USB Dongle 4.0 Update Tool, used by manufacturers to upgrade chips like the BR17, BR21, and BR22.     Frequently appears as a USB Sound Card rather than a standard Bluetooth dongle. Common Troubleshooting

    Shown as Storage Device: Some BR21 dongles mistakenly mount as a CD-ROM/Storage device to provide manuals or drivers. To fix this on Linux, use usb_modeswitch with the specific vendor/product ID.

    Missing Bluetooth Button: If Windows sees the device as an "Audio Device" but does not show the Bluetooth toggle, it is because the chip is handling the Bluetooth connection internally (acting as a wireless bridge) and presenting only the final audio stream to the PC.

    Pairing Issues: Ensure the device is in pairing mode (often indicated by a flashing blue LED). Some mixers require a physical "ST/USB" or "PC" button to be toggled to activate the Jieli interface. Driver Resources

    Official Downloads: Direct "full" driver packages from Zhuhai Jieli are rarely provided to end-users as they are intended for OEMs.

    Automated Updates: Use the Windows Device Manager to search for "Generic Bluetooth" or "USB Audio" updates if the device is not functioning.

    The JieLi BR21 (often identified as the Jieli Technology USB Composite Device with ID 4c4a:4155) is technically an audio receiver/transmitter rather than a standard Bluetooth dongle. Because it functions as a "USB Sound Card," it typically does not require a manual driver installation on modern operating systems like Windows 10/11 or Ubuntu. Quick Setup Guide

    Driverless Operation: Your computer should recognize it as a generic "USB Audio Device." Once plugged in, check your Sound Settings—it should appear as a playback or recording device. Pairing Mode: Plug the device into a USB port.

    Wait for the blue LED to start flashing quickly (this indicates pairing mode).

    Put your Bluetooth headphones or speakers into pairing mode.

    The devices should automatically link without software intervention.

    Common Issue (Storage Mode): If the device appears as a "CD Drive" or storage device, it may be stuck in a configuration mode. On Linux systems, some users use usb_modeswitch to force it into audio mode. Where to Find Software

    JieLi BR21 is a specialized Bluetooth-to-USB bridge chipset manufactured by ZhuHai Jieli Technology Co., Ltd

    . It is commonly used in low-cost Bluetooth audio receivers, transmitters, and USB sound cards rather than being a standard "Bluetooth dongle" that provides a full Bluetooth stack to a PC. Ask Ubuntu Driver Overview

    For most modern operating systems, the JieLi BR21 is designed to be driverless (Plug-and-Play). Ask Ubuntu Functionality: It typically presents itself to the operating system as a USB Composite Device USB Audio Device

    . Because it uses standard USB audio and HID classes, it utilizes the generic drivers built into Windows and Linux. Operating Systems:

    It is compatible with Windows 7, 8, 10, and 11, as well as Linux distributions like Ubuntu. Ask Ubuntu Common Identification & Behavior

    If you are troubleshooting the device, it often appears in Device Manager under these names: USB Composite Device JieLi BR21 (or JieLi BR17, which uses similar firmware) BR21 UBOOT1.00 (when in a specific bootloader or "update" mode) USB Audio Device Troubleshooting & Configuration
